Types of Window Glass
When considering window glass replacement, it's necessary to understand the various types readily available. double glazing repairs near me has its specific qualities and advantages. Here's a comparative table of various window glass types:
Type of Glass
Description
Advantages
Single-Pane Glass
A single layer of glass.
Cost-effective, uncomplicated installation.
Double-Pane Glass
Two layers of glass with an area in between filled with gas.
Improved insulation, energy-efficient, noise reduction.
Triple-Pane Glass
3 layers of glass with two gas-filled areas.
Maximum energy performance, excellent soundproofing.
Laminated Glass
Two pieces of glass with a plastic interlayer.
Safety, UV security, sound insulation.
Tempered Glass
Heat-treated glass that's much more powerful.
Shatter-proof, security in high-impact areas.
Low-E Glass
Covered glass that reflects heat and UV radiation.
Energy cost savings, minimizes fading of interiors.
The Glass Replacement Process
The procedure of window glass replacement typically includes several essential steps. Here's a breakdown of what homeowner can expect:
1. Assessment
- Examination: A professional will examine the window to assess the damage and identify the type of glass needed.
- Measurement: Accurate measurements are taken to ensure the new glass fits completely.
2. Choice of Glass
- Assessment: Homeowners go over choices for glass types based on their requirements and choices.
- Expense Estimate: A quote is supplied, detailing costs for products and labor.
3. Removal of Old Glass
- Preparation: The area around the window is prepared to avoid damage.
- Removal: The old glass is thoroughly gotten rid of, particularly if it's shattered to avoid injury.
4. Installation of New Glass
- Fitting: The brand-new glass is installed into the frame, guaranteeing a tight fit.
- Sealing: Proper sealing is done to avoid air and water leaks.
5. Ending up Touches
- Cleaning up: The location is tidied up, and the glass is wiped down.
- Final Inspection: A final check is made to ensure the installation is secure and working properly.
6. Follow-Up Care
- Directions: Homeowners receive directions on care and maintenance of the new glass.

Regularly Asked Questions
1. Just how much does window glass replacement expense?
The expense can differ based on factors such as the type of glass, window size, and labor costs. Usually, house owners can expect to pay between ₤ 200 and ₤ 500 per window, including setup.
2. The length of time does the replacement process take?
A lot of window glass replacement jobs can be completed within a couple of hours to a full day, depending upon the intricacy and variety of windows involved.
3. Can I replace just the glass instead of the whole window?
Yes, in lots of cases, just the glass pane requires to be changed, specifically if the frame is still in excellent condition.
4. What are the benefits of double or triple-pane glass?
Double and triple-pane glass offer enhanced insulation, which can substantially decrease heating and cooling costs and enhance indoor comfort.
5. Is it essential to work with a professional for window glass replacement?
While some experienced DIYers might attempt this task, employing a professional is typically suggested for security, appropriate setup, and service warranty purposes.
